From sculptures that manipulate light to immersive environments that surround viewers with perception-shifting projection and illumination, light has rapidly become a prominent medium in today's visual art practice. In this hands-on course, we will create several light-based sculptures and/or installations while exploring our own interests in the illuminated world around us. During the course, we'll look to foundational Light and Space artists, like James Turrell and Olafur Eliasson, and discover cutting edge international lighting artists in order to gain inspiration for our work.
